Frequently Asked Questions

How do art subject dictionaries differ from general art history books?
Art subject dictionaries, like those by Westview Press or Harper & Row, focus specifically on cataloging and explaining the meanings of symbols, figures, and narratives found in art. General art history books, conversely, typically provide broader overviews of artistic movements, periods, and artists, often integrating thematic discussions within a chronological or stylistic framework.
Are interactive art books effective for learning about themes?
Interactive books, such as "The Art Lover’s Sticker Book," can be effective for visual engagement and sparking interest in art, but they typically offer a curated selection rather than comprehensive thematic explanations. While they can introduce various art subjects, they are generally not designed for in-depth academic study of symbolism or historical context.
